- The distance between Amherst, Ma, Usa and Anderson, Sc, Usa is approximately 1,166 km or 725 mi.
- To reach Amherst, Ma in this distance one would set out from Anderson, Sc bearing 45.2° or NE and follow the great circles arc to approach Amherst, Ma bearing 51.4° or NE .
- Amherst, Ma has a hot summer continental climate with no dry season (Dfa) whereas Anderson, Sc has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a).
- Both are in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ome.
- The average annual temperature is 6.9 °C (12.4°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 6.3 °C (11.3°F) more in Amherst, Ma.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to semicont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 236.6 mm (9.3 in) less which is equivalent to 236.6 l/m² (5.81 US gal/ft²) or 2,366,000 l/ha (252,941 US gal/ac) less. About 5/6 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 7° lower in Amherst, Ma than in Anderson, Sc.
